Collegium Pharmaceuticals Inc., a Cumberland-based developer of late-stage drugs that add market value and clinical benefit to existing products, has raised $5.5 million in Series C funding, according to a regulatory filing.
Backers include Boston Millennia Partners and Westfield Capital Management.

Collegium is a privately held company that focuses on uses for pharmaceuticals already on the market, many of which are coming off patent. It was founded in 2002, by a group of senior pharmaceutical executives.
“We believe that large market opportunities exist in the development of product improvements and line extensions strategies, all protected by strong intellectual property,” they say on the company’s Web site.
